On the occasion of the ninth anniversary of Noshirvan Mustafa's death;
Noshirvan Mustafa Cheriki intellectual
Service of Iraq and Kurdistan Region - Noshirvan Mustafa Amin, born in 1944 in Sulaymaniyah, the city of the uprising and revolution of Iraqi Kurdistan, is one of the self-made and unique political figures of Iraqi Kurds. In the second decade of his life, he got acquainted with the Kurdish struggle movement led by Mulla Mustafa Barzani, and then he joined the youth of the Iraqi Kurdistan Democratic Party in Sulaymaniyah.
